At some time, police shutdowns experienced caused quite a few venues to shut (such as his individual US Studio), so Williams took the abandoned manufacturing facility at 206 Jefferson Road and began hosting events at it—christening the location as ‘the Warehouse.’

The former manufacturing facility quickly came to everyday living at nighttime, with predominantly gay Black and Latino crowds coming with each other to dance within an or else intensely segregated club scene. Alongside other innovators like Ron Hardy, the Warehouse’s very first musical director and resident DJ Frankie Knuckles begun experimenting with new Seems for the venue by mixing disco and soul tracks with electronic beats—supplying birth to what we now know as house music.
